在如今的技术时代,GitHub不仅是一个代码托管平台,更是展示个人技能和项目的重要场所。无论你是学生、初入职场的开发者,还是资深工程师,优化你的GitHub个人主页可以让你在求职、项目合作中脱颖而出。本文将深入探讨如何有效地利用GitHub个人主页展示你的技能、项目及成就。
1. 什么是GitHub个人主页
GitHub个人主页是一个用于展示用户的公共资料页面。通过这个页面,其他用户可以了解到你的代码贡献、参与的项目、技能等信息。一个吸引人的个人主页可以增强你在开源社区中的影响力。
2. 如何设置GitHub个人主页
2.1 创建GitHub个人主页
- 注册账户: 首先,你需要在GitHub上注册一个账户。
- 创建新的仓库: 将仓库命名为
username.github.io
(其中username
是你的GitHub用户名)。 - 上传主页内容: 将你的HTML、CSS、JavaScript文件上传到该仓库中,GitHub会自动为你生成个人主页。
2.2 使用Markdown编辑个人简介
Markdown是一种轻量级的标记语言,GitHub个人主页支持使用Markdown来格式化内容。你可以在README文件中使用Markdown来书写个人介绍、项目描述和技术栈等。
3. 展示项目
3.1 如何选择展示的项目
选择展示的项目应该考虑以下几点:
- 项目的技术栈: 确保选择与你所掌握的技术栈相符的项目。
- 项目的受欢迎程度: 选择一些有star或fork的项目,显示你的贡献受到了认可。
- 个人贡献度: 优先选择自己主导或参与度高的项目。
3.2 在个人主页上展示项目的方式
- 项目简介: 对每个项目提供简短的介绍,说明项目的功能和用途。
- 技术栈: 列出每个项目使用的技术栈,可以使用图标表示。
- 链接到项目: 确保每个项目都有指向GitHub仓库的链接,以便他人能轻松访问。
4. 展示技能
4.1 如何展示你的技能
- 使用徽章: 你可以使用shields.io等网站生成技能徽章,增加视觉效果。
- 技能列表: 列出你的技能,如编程语言、框架和工具等。
4.2 技能的排序
- 按熟练程度: 可以将技能按熟练程度进行排序,帮助他人快速了解你的技术水平。
- 最新技术: 突出你最近学习和应用的新技术,显示你的学习能力。
5. 提升个人主页的吸引力
5.1 使用自定义主题
通过选择一个合适的主题,增强你的个人主页的美观性和用户体验。
5.2 互动与社交
- 引导交流: 鼓励访问者与你联系,提供邮箱或社交媒体链接。
- 参与开源项目: 定期更新项目并积极参与其他人的项目,提高个人主页的活跃度。
6. FAQ(常见问题解答)
6.1 GitHub个人主页的优势是什么?
GitHub个人主页可以帮助你在开源社区中建立专业形象,展示你的技能和项目,提高在求职时的竞争力。
6.2 如何维护和更新个人主页?
定期检查并更新个人主页上的信息,确保所有项目和技能都是最新的。同时,定期增加新项目和参与开源活动。
6.3 我能展示多少个项目?
没有具体限制,但建议展示3到5个最具代表性的项目,以确保访问者能够专注于你的最强项。
6.4 是否可以通过GitHub个人主页寻找工作机会?
是的,许多公司会查看候选人的GitHub个人主页来评估其技能和项目经验,因此优化你的主页可以增加获得面试的机会。
7. 结论
一个精心设计的GitHub个人主页不仅能帮助你展示技能和项目,还能提高你在技术社区中的能见度。通过合理利用GitHub的功能和工具,你可以让你的个人主页更加吸引人,从而吸引更多的合作机会和职业发展。希望这篇文章能帮助你优化你的GitHub个人主页!
正文完